Research Methodology and Writing 2013 Fall
Paper Size • 1) letter size: 8½-by-11 inch • 2) No greater than 6½-by-9 inch (A4 paper)
Margins • Standard: 1 inch at the top and bottom and on both sides • Also accepted: the default format of Microsoft Word processor for A4 size
Text Formatting • Typeface: Times New Roman • size: 12 points • Do not justify the lines of text at the right margin • Turn off the automatic hyphenation feature • Leave one space after a period or other concluding punctuation mark • One side print • 1.5 line space (as ruled in 學生手冊)
Capitalization of your title • See MLA 3.6.1 • Basic rules • The usage of colon
Place for Page Numbers • The upper right-hand corner, one-half inch from the tip and flush with the right margin • (its format will be for quiz)
Quiz: Do you need a title paper for your research paper? ---No. ---Use the headings on the first page to put the essential information
Quiz: Where is the place on the first page to put your headings? Beginning on the top of your paper and flush with the left margin
Quiz: What are the items to list for your headings? Your name Your instructor’s name The course number (the course title) The date
Quiz: Do you need extra line space between headings and the title of the paper ? No!
Quiz: Where is the place to put the title (to flush with the left, the right or to center it)? You need to center the title
Quiz: What is the space for indention at the beginning of a paragraph? One-half inch (5 spaces)
Quiz: What is the text format for your page numbers ---Your last name and leave a space before the page number ---No other punctuation is needed in between
